Why Gail Honeyman’s *Eleanor Oliphant Is Completely Fine* Is Necessary
I believe this novel is necessary because it speaks honestly about loneliness in a way that feels deeply human. Through Eleanor’s voice, I could see how isolation can hide behind routine, politeness, and even humor. Her story reminded me that many people are struggling quietly, and that kindness can matter more than we often realize.
My experience of reading it also showed me how important it is to understand mental health without judgment. Eleanor is not simply “odd” or “difficult”; she is someone shaped by pain, trauma, and disconnection. Gail Honeyman writes her with empathy, and that made me reflect on how easy it is to misunderstand people when we only see the surface.
I think the book is also necessary because it offers hope without pretending life becomes perfect. Eleanor’s growth feels believable and earned, which made me appreciate the power of small changes, friendship, and self-acceptance. For me, that is what makes the novel so valuable: it reminds us that healing is possible, and that being seen can change a life.
